首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Vue.js混合在组件中不能正常工作

Vue.js是一种流行的JavaScript框架,用于构建用户界面。它采用了组件化的开发方式,使得前端开发更加简洁和高效。然而,有时候在Vue.js中使用混合(mixins)时可能会遇到一些问题,导致混合在组件中不能正常工作。

混合是一种在多个组件之间共享代码的方式。通过混合,我们可以将一些通用的逻辑、方法或数据注入到多个组件中,以避免重复编写相同的代码。然而,当混合使用不当时,可能会导致一些意外的问题。

在Vue.js中,混合的使用应该遵循一些最佳实践和规范。首先,确保混合的命名不会与组件中已有的属性或方法冲突。其次,避免在混合中修改组件的状态,以免造成不可预料的结果。另外,混合应该尽量保持简单和可维护,避免过度使用混合,以免增加代码的复杂性。

如果在使用Vue.js混合时遇到问题,可以尝试以下解决方法:

  1. 检查命名冲突:确保混合的命名不会与组件中已有的属性或方法冲突。可以给混合的属性和方法添加前缀或命名空间,以避免冲突。
  2. 检查混合的使用方式:确保混合被正确地引入到组件中。在Vue.js中,可以使用mixins选项将混合应用到组件中。
  3. 检查混合的顺序:如果组件同时使用了多个混合,确保它们的顺序正确。Vue.js会按照混合的顺序依次调用混合中的方法。
  4. 检查混合的内容:检查混合中的代码是否正确,是否符合Vue.js的语法和规范。可以参考Vue.js官方文档或相关教程来学习如何正确地编写和使用混合。

总结起来,Vue.js混合在组件中不能正常工作可能是由于命名冲突、使用方式错误、顺序问题或混合内容错误等原因导致的。在使用混合时,应该遵循Vue.js的最佳实践和规范,确保混合能够正常工作。

腾讯云相关产品和产品介绍链接地址:

请注意,以上链接仅供参考,具体的产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券